{"product_id":"ge-fanuc-531x300cchadm3-control-board","title":"GE Fanuc 531X300CCHBDM3 Control Board","description":"\u003ch3\u003eDescription\u003c\/h3\u003e\u003cp\u003eThe 531X300CCHBDM3 is a specialized Control Card within the GE AX Control series, designed for legacy General Electric drive systems including the DC 300 platform. This board serves as the central logic unit for drive regulation, enabling precise motor control and signal processing in demanding industrial environments. It is a critical component for maintaining legacy infrastructure in sectors such as steel manufacturing, paper processing, and heavy-duty material handling, providing a reliable replacement for aging or failing control hardware.\u003c\/p\u003e\u003ch3\u003eFeatures\u003c\/h3\u003e\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eSignal Regulation:\u003c\/strong\u003e Equipped with eight potentiometers for precise adjustment of control parameters and analog signal scaling.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eDiagnostic Interface:\u003c\/strong\u003e Features six red LED status indicators and a dedicated manual reset switch to facilitate efficient system troubleshooting.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eHardware Architecture:\u003c\/strong\u003e High-density PCB design featuring integrated circuits and robust power filtering components, including transformers and capacitors for stable voltage distribution.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eModular Expansion:\u003c\/strong\u003e Includes two sets of four standoffs to support the integration of auxiliary boards via vertical pin headers.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eMechanical Design:\u003c\/strong\u003e Factory-drilled at all four corners to support standard rack or panel mounting within industrial drive enclosures.\u003c\/li\u003e\n\u003c\/ul\u003e\u003ch3\u003eApplications\u003c\/h3\u003e\u003cp\u003eThis control board is primarily utilized in legacy GE drive systems, specifically the DC 300 series.
